Description
English: Diomedes and Polyxena. Side B from an Etruscan amphora of the Pontic group, ca. 540–530 BC. From Vulci.
Français : Diomède et Polyxène. Face B d'une amphore pontique, vers 540-530 av. J.-C. Provenance : Vulci.
Dimensions H. 38 cm (14 ¾ in.), Diam. 27.5 cm (10 ¾ in.)
